Community focused and evidence informed disease outbreak response: Sharing experiences from Sub-Saharan Africa and Latin America

Session Information

We explore how the planetary crisis and recurrence of disease outbreaks in sub-Saharan Africa and Latin America that require communities to be adaptable and resilient. Diseases such as cholera are occurring with increasing frequency and lasting for longer periods of time as presented by the case studies from Somalia and Mozambique and dengue in Latin America. While highly infectious hemorrhagic fever diseases such as Marburg are threatening the existing fragile health system in countries like Tanzania. We end the panel taking a broader view of disease outbreaks across the two continents to not only be vigilant of routine disease threats but to invest in community level surveillance, routine preventive practices, addressing gender dynamics, reliance on positive deviant approaches and technology-driven solutions for risk communication and community engagement to be part of a systems approach to be ready for new threats.
